Valley Brook Tea coming to old Starbucks space in Dupont


21st and P Street, NW

Thanks to David for sharing the news:

“Excited to see Valley Brook Tea coming into the old Starbucks location at 21&P in Dupont. Had a great chat with the owner who hopes to open in late December. The company has a great story, too!”
